FYI

There is a Virus/Worm out there that got me to look. Beware, especially when you guys may be waiting for back ordered parts.

See below for the email I got. Look at the misspelled couldn’t.

I have been waiting a long time for my roll bar and had to look.

This was a virus. I can't beleive I fell for it. :confused:


:mad: :mad: :mad: :mad:



FedEx notice,

The delivery service couldn’t deliver your package.
The package weight exceeds the allowable free-delivery limit.

You have to receive your packagen personally.
Print out the "Invoice Copy" attached and collect the package at our office.

Please read carefully the attached information before receiving your package.

Thank you for attention. FedEx Logistics Services.
